The Picanol Group is an international, customer-oriented group specialized in the development, production and sale of weaving machines engineered casting solutions and custom-made controllers.
Division Weaving Machines: Picanol develops, manufactures and sells high-tech weaving machines based on air (airjet) or rapier technology. Picanol supplies weaving machines to weaving mills worldwide, and also offers its customers such products and services as weaving accessories, training, upgrade kits and spare parts. For more than 80 years, Picanol has played a pioneering role in the industry worldwide, and is one of the current world leaders in weaving machine production. Division Industries: Proferro comprises the foundry and the group’s machining activities. It produces cast iron parts for e.g. compressors, agricultural machinery, and Picanol weaving machines. PsiControl specializes in the design, development, manufacturing and support custom-made controllers for various industries. In addition to the manufacture of high-precision metal parts, mold making and the revision of dies, Melotte has been involved in the 3D printing of parts for several years.
In addition to the headquarters in Ypres (Belgium), the Picanol Group has production facilities in Asia and Europe, linked to its own worldwide sales and service network. In 2019, the Picanol Group realized a consolidated turnover of 2221 million euros. The Picanol Group employs some 2,300 employees worldwide and is listed on Euronext Brussels (PIC). The Picanol Group was founded in 1936. Since 2013, the Picanol Group has also had a reference interest in the Tessenderlo Group (Euronext: TESB).
